Economy & Jobs

Dunbar residents earn a median household income of $54,647 , which is 27% below the national average of $75,149. Per capita income is $31,117. The unemployment rate stands at 1.3% (64% below the U.S. rate of 3.6%). 12.1% of residents live below the poverty line. The area is home to 6,860 business establishments, including 428 restaurants.

Housing & Cost of Living

The median home value in Dunbar is $121,100 , 57% below the national median of $281,900. Zillow estimates the typical home at $121,237. Median rent is $904/month, with 28.4% of renters spending more than 30% of income on housing. The cost of living index is 89.5 (100 = national average). The median home was built in 1958.

Safety & Crime

Dunbar reports 166 violent crimes per 100,000 residents , which is 56% below the national average of 380/100K. Property crime is 2,404/100K. The murder rate is 0.0/100K.

Education

30.8% of adults in Dunbar hold a bachelor's degree or higher (9% below the national average). 93.7% have completed high school. Local schools score 5.1/10 in standardized testing.

Climate & Weather

Dunbar has an average annual temperature of 54°F (12°C). Winters average 33°F in January while summers reach 75°F in July. The area gets 293 sunny days per year. Annual precipitation totals 48.2 inches. Air quality is rated Good with a median AQI of 39.
